REV. ROBERT C. FANNON Administrator SISTER MARY OF THE ANGELS, H.H.M. Girls' Principal BROTHER FRANCIS BENILDE, F.S.C Boys' Principal Dear Seniors: It seems hut yesterday that we hid you hello; it seems impossible that the tomorrow has arrived when we must hid you farewell. We have enjoyed our day with you. We are delighted to have shared with your parents the privilege of educating you, or leading you forth to the day when you must try your hand at your vocation in life. What we have attempted to do is best described by Father Michael Larkin in his work “Do We Need Religious Education?” when he says, “To he complete, education must aim at the harmonious development of the whole man and all his faculties, and train him to use these noble endowments for the highest purpose of life. To cultivate and strengthen man, body and soul, mind and heart and conscience—this is the business of true education.” Our prayer is that we have helped form that Christian character that will serve you even if misfortune should sweep away your every gain, or calamity leave you friendless; that Christian character that will leave your ear attuned always to your eternal calling, your vocation of eternal happiness. We hid you a confessor’s farewell—“Go in Peace and God bless you!” Yours always in Christ, Father Fannon

JOHN RUSSO 1941 • 1959 Our senior year was saddened by the death of classmate John Russo. In our sorrow, we were uplifted by a sense of pride in praying for Johnny’s eternal salvation. For he was a true representative of Central Catholic— a boy who took his Faith as an integral part of his life, and always strove to maintain this ideal. Imitating his charity, we humbly pray, Requiescal in pace.
